The global bacterial vaginosis market is experiencing significant growth, primarily driven by the increasing prevalence of bacterial vaginosis. The rise in bacterial vaginosis cases can be attributed to various factors, including changes in lifestyle, sexual behavior, and hygiene practices. Factors such as an increase in sexual activity, multiple sexual partners, and inconsistent use of barrier methods, i.e., condoms, can disrupt the natural vaginal flora, leading to an imbalance in bacterial populations and a higher incidence of bacterial vaginosis. Additionally, lifestyle practices, including douching, which can alter the vaginal microbiome, contribute to a higher risk of developing bacterial vaginosis. This increasing prevalence has raised awareness among both healthcare providers and the general population, encouraging more women to seek diagnosis and treatment. As the number of bacterial vaginosis cases continues to rise, there is a greater demand for innovative treatment options, antibiotics, probiotics, and even preventive therapies, thus driving market growth.

One of the significant drivers of the global bacterial vaginosis market is the advances in probiotics and antimicrobial therapies, which have contributed to the bacterial vaginosis market's growth. Probiotics, particularly those containing lactobacillus, are gaining attention for their potential to restore the natural balance of bacteria in the vagina and reduce the recurrence of bacterial vaginosis. The growing body of research around the vaginal microbiome has provided insights into how specific bacterial strains can prevent or treat bacterial vaginosis. Similarly, the development of new antimicrobial therapies with fewer side effects and increased effectiveness is driving the demand for advanced treatments.

Despite the positive growth trajectory, several challenges continue to impact the global bacterial vaginosis market. One of the primary challenges is the side effects of current treatments. Some current treatments for bacterial vaginosis, especially oral antibiotics and topical creams, can cause side effects such as gastrointestinal distress, vaginal irritation, or allergic reactions. These side effects can deter patients from completing their prescribed treatment regimens or encourage them to seek alternative, often unproven, therapies. The presence of side effects can undermine patient confidence in pharmaceutical solutions, limiting the overall market growth for bacterial vaginosis treatments.
